Обеспечить соблюдение правил именования файлов в Windows Share? - PullRequest
2 голосов
/ 12 мая 2009

Простой вопрос, но я нигде не могу найти ответ. Есть ли способ в Windows или с помощью сторонней утилиты обеспечить соблюдение правил именования файлов в общей сетевой папке Windows?

Я уверен, что это легко сделать в Sharepoint, но я хочу иметь возможность ограничивать пользователей форматом имени файла, который они сохраняют в папке. Я мог бы создать программу после сохранения, чтобы искать и искать исключения после факта, но я хочу попытаться заставить пользователя назвать файлы в соответствии с нашими стандартами при сохранении.

Если что-то недоступно / не настраивается на стороне сервера, можно ли это сделать с помощью VBA в Excel или Word в диалоге сохранения файла?

Спасибо за вашу помощь.

A

Ответы [ 3 ]

0 голосов
/ 12 мая 2009

Как насчет мониторинга папки на предмет изменений, и как только файл с «неправильным» именем файла создается, вы каким-то образом предупреждаете пользователя?

В идеале вы хотели бы иметь какую-то «зацепку» на уровне файловой системы, которая также позволит вам не выполнить файловую операцию, если имя файла неверное; но я не думаю, что есть что-то на уровне пользователя (не ядра), которое делает это.

0 голосов
/ 12 мая 2009

Вам потребуется написать программу, которая будет действовать как шлюз для общего ресурса, чтобы обеспечить это. Вам также придется ограничить доступ к общему ресурсу, чтобы пользователи не могли обойти программу.

0 голосов
/ 12 мая 2009

Насколько мне известно, нет ничего, что могло бы ограничить имена файлов.

Ничего, если ты сам не напишешь.

...